One of the most important restaurant cleaning supplies is a high-quality disinfectant. In a busy restaurant setting, surfaces can quickly become contaminated with bacteria and other harmful pathogens. Using a powerful disinfectant can help to kill these germs and prevent the spread of illness among staff and customers. It is important to choose a disinfectant that is effective against a wide range of bacteria and viruses, including common foodborne pathogens like E. coli and Salmonella.
Another essential cleaning supply for restaurants is a good degreaser. In a commercial kitchen, grease and grime can build up quickly on surfaces such as countertops, stovetops, and range hoods. A degreaser is designed to cut through tough grease and leave surfaces clean and shiny. By regularly using a degreaser, restaurant staff can ensure that their kitchen is not only sanitary but also safe from potential fire hazards caused by grease buildup.
When it comes to cleaning the dining area, having the right cleaning cloths and towels is essential. Microfiber cloths are a popular choice for restaurants because they are highly absorbent, durable, and effective at picking up dirt and grime. Using microfiber cloths can help to reduce the use of disposable paper towels, making them an environmentally friendly option for restaurant cleaning. Additionally, having a supply of clean towels on hand at all times ensures that staff can quickly wipe down tables, chairs, and other surfaces between guest seatings.
In addition to disinfectants, degreasers, and cleaning cloths, there are several other essential restaurant cleaning supplies that every establishment should have in their arsenal. These include:
– All-purpose cleaner: A versatile cleaning product that can be used on a variety of surfaces, including countertops, floors, and walls.
– Floor cleaner: A specially formulated cleaner designed to remove dirt, grease, and grime from restaurant floors.
– Glass cleaner: A streak-free cleaner that is perfect for keeping windows, mirrors, and glass display cases sparkling clean.
– Stainless steel cleaner: A specialized cleaner that is designed to polish and protect stainless steel surfaces, such as sinks, appliances, and prep tables.
– Trash bags and liners: Essential supplies for disposing of waste and keeping trash cans clean and odor-free.

In addition to having the right cleaning supplies on hand, it is also important for restaurant staff to follow proper cleaning protocols and techniques. This includes using the correct dilution ratios for cleaning products, following recommended contact times for disinfectants, and properly storing cleaning supplies when not in use. Training staff on the importance of cleanliness and providing them with the necessary tools and resources to keep the restaurant clean is essential for creating a culture of cleanliness and professionalism within the establishment.
